About The Position

Lamb Weston is currently searching for an Engineering Project Manager to lead projects supporting the production of frozen potato products. This person will be responsible for managing and directing projects of varying size and scope. Projects may include investigating or developing processes, developing project concepts and budgets, troubleshooting or investigating technical issues or implementing capital projects. Project Managers also assist in the development of engineering resources, procedures and best practices. Project Managers may at times direct or be part of a project team(s). Project work including design, Capital Request write-ups, preparing and presenting project reviews, developing contractor bid packages, overseeing project installation, cost tracking, training and startup assistance as well as post project support are normal work activities. The position will participate in various project teams and work independently as required by the various assignments. This position requires the ability to travel and participate in projects at various locations in North America as required to meet the project requirements. Working closely with the various levels of Procurement, Operations Management, EHSS, Food Protection, Engineering, Continuous Improvement, Plant Staff, and Production Personnel is critical. This position coordinates activities with LW operations and is based out of our Kennewick, Washington, engineering office.
